Message Serialization

Message Serialization is the process of converting complex data structures or objects into a format that can be stored or transmitted across a network. In cryptocurrency trading, this is used to package orders and trade requests for transmission to the exchange.

The serialization format must be efficient to minimize packet size and transmission time. Common formats include Protocol Buffers or custom binary structures, which are designed for high-speed encoding and decoding.

A poorly chosen serialization format can introduce significant latency, as the CPU must spend time transforming the data. Serialization must also be secure to prevent injection attacks or data manipulation.

In the context of FPGAs, this process can be offloaded to hardware, allowing for near-instantaneous serialization of trade messages. It is a critical link in the chain of communication between the trading engine and the exchange.

Effective serialization ensures that messages are delivered reliably and quickly.

Zero-Copy Memory
Managerial Efforts
Validator Node Allocation
Prospectus
Crypto Hedge Funds
Authorized Participants
Margin Call Pressure
Protocol Revenue Accrual

Glossary

Financial Data Integrity

Data ⎊ ⎊ Financial data integrity within cryptocurrency, options trading, and financial derivatives signifies the completeness, accuracy, consistency, and reliability of information utilized for valuation, risk management, and regulatory reporting.

Financial History Analysis

Methodology ⎊ Financial History Analysis involves the rigorous examination of temporal price data and order book evolution to identify recurring patterns in cryptocurrency markets.

High Speed Encoding

Algorithm ⎊ High Speed Encoding, within the context of cryptocurrency derivatives and options trading, represents a suite of optimized computational techniques designed to minimize latency and maximize throughput in order execution.

Low Latency Data Feeds

Requirement ⎊ Low latency data feeds are a fundamental requirement for efficient and competitive trading in crypto derivatives, delivering market information with minimal delay.

Financial Data Governance

Data ⎊ ⎊ Financial Data Governance within cryptocurrency, options trading, and financial derivatives establishes a framework for managing the integrity, reliability, and accessibility of information assets.

Cryptocurrency Exchange Protocols

Algorithm ⎊ Cryptocurrency exchange protocols fundamentally rely on algorithmic execution to match orders and facilitate trade completion, often employing variations of order book matching engines or automated market makers.

Consensus Validation Mechanisms

Algorithm ⎊ ⎊ Consensus validation mechanisms, within decentralized systems, rely heavily on algorithmic structures to establish trust and secure network operations.

Financial Data Serialization

Data ⎊ Financial data serialization within cryptocurrency, options trading, and financial derivatives represents the systematic conversion of complex data structures into a standardized format for efficient storage, transmission, and reconstruction.

Secure Data Storage

Custody ⎊ Secure data storage within cryptocurrency, options trading, and financial derivatives necessitates robust custodial practices, extending beyond simple encryption to encompass multi-factor authentication and geographically distributed key management.

Quantitative Finance Modeling

Model ⎊ Quantitative Finance Modeling, within the context of cryptocurrency, options trading, and financial derivatives, represents a sophisticated application of mathematical and statistical techniques to price, manage, and trade complex financial instruments.